于软发开件范畴中,Qt是被个广泛以用创建平跨台应用的序程框架,该框持支架C++、QM多等L样编言语程。Qt版源开也就是 tQOpe n,其允开许发者支不于付许用费可之际用使Qt库,条件是守遵要或者G协LP议。此情于对形个人发开者或创初者公司而言,是一经种济高效择选的。本文会对针Qt源开版的安过装程予以测评,着重剖不析同安装的式方易用性稳及以定性,助力初者学能够快上速手。结果以会排行式形予以现呈,会结术技合方面的节细与实际拥所有的据数,以此来证保内容详实且尽在、值得信 赖。
我们选挑了四种的见常Qt开形源式安办装法,涵盖官装安方程序、第三方管包理器、源代译编码以和容化器安装。评测含准标有装置间时、依赖理管、错误率(依据问见常题实施计统)以及支区社持度。测试环为境 22.04与 11系统,运用tQ 6.5版本。数据自源Qt方官文档S及以ta kc的2023年调报研告,展现概大出30%的初学首在者次安装碰时之到依赖题问。
Qt官装安方程序,是Q开t源版方种那式令选首人所呈现况情的。专门而言,尤为适手新合。它把个一图形界化面供给人他所展的现情形下,可以做动自好依赖还库有路予径以设置事之。依据对助借Qt官细详网数据的关相分析,利用方官安装序程达成果效成功成会率功高达95%之状现出,平均用安于装进行时的间大就约在10 – 15分钟以可处寻得数应相值。对于所现实要安装所关应相联进骤步行一事去一进步说明,涵盖况状有下于属载在线那装安端器予以载下,选择就来源开许可做而从实现达成,来勾选部需所件组型类合(像是iMnGWM者或SV译编C器这种例实)。举例说如明此这般形情,在系个这统环境中当,安装程能序够自去动落实置配环境变这量件大事此由来施此行事,进而至达减少动手操作容现出易错误况情的会得以现呈。除此以外,官方的档文当中出给了事巨无细的故排障除方指的面南,像是理处去网络超现出时这况情种或者限权是方面题问的,以此障保来安装能程过够平畅顺滑进行 。
一种虚构为Nexus的包管理器,作为第三方工具存在,适用于Linux、macOS系统,借助命令行实现安装简化,它集成众多软件源,可快速下载Qt库及其依赖,于系统里,运用命令sud onexsu tq6就能完成,平均安装时间大概8分钟,然而,依据社区反馈,Nexus的版本更新兴许滞后,进而引发兼容性问题,举例来讲,在测期试间,大约15%的用户汇报了库冲突情况,需手动调节路径 。虽说效率是比较高的,然而稳定性稍微比官方方式低一些,它适合那些存在一定经验的开发者。
采用码源编译的装安方式能许准够高度的义定自,然而程过其繁杂,并不适新宜手。用户从要需Qt官儿那网下载源码代,运用CaMkeM及以ak具工e来进行译编。在理情的想形之下,编译耗所费的时有间可能超过1小时,而且还由易容于系统的境环差异而致导失败。比如说,在测试期间,系统大面上约25%的编试尝译会因缺为失库被而迫中断。尽管样这的方式对够能性能予优以化:但错率误较高,并且还缺欠即时的持支,仅仅荐推给高级户用。
以容器化技术做到环境隔离减少系统冲突的安装方式,用户能够拉取预构建的Qt镜像,其用到的命令像 pllu qt:6.5 。该种方式于团队协作里的优势显著,然而资源消耗多并且对刚接触新手不太友好 。据测试得知,安装平均用时20分钟,而且有大约30%的用户在配置网络权限过程遭到麻烦 。除此之外,它得要有额外的知识,这增添了学习成本,所以评分不高 。
归结言而,Qt版源开有着的样多安装方式,新手应先优当选用官安方装程节来序省时及以间精力,随着技到得能提升,能够别试尝的方获去式取更多性活灵,在安装程进当中,必须要守遵开源协议,还要考参官方社去区取得更新,值得留是的意,近期技科界里首如面例“医保价”脑机手口接术完成的类之热点,展现出开了源技在术医疗创中新存在的用应潜力,这同Q有具t的跨理台平念互相应对,凸显技及普术具备值价的 。



